Abstract

PURPOSE: To make it possible to produce antistatic fibers at high operating efficiency, by combining a component consisting mainly of a block polymer of a polyalkylene glycol with a fiber-forming polymer component to form composite fibers of specific arrangement.
CONSTITUTION: The component A consisting mainly of a block polymer of polyalkylene glycol segments is combined with the polymer component B, e.g.a polyolefin, polyamide, or polyester, having improved fiber-forming properties to form composite fibers, wherein one of the components A and B occupies a continuous zone including the center of the fiber cross-section, and the other component is divided into plural zones which are arranged in the form of rotation symmetry to expose themselves or extend to each fiber surface, the both components being continuous along the fiber. The component A occupies at least 20% of the fiber surface.
